Output c590db29bda6d968705af67c84b4aeed338ed7870b42f1feee2556dbbac4bfd7:3

value
15000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bacc5e613b36e61c938e36329aee4382ad9909c OP_EQUAL
address
3JoMFu1GoGz5kWV7SdFzXM27vyYjZ4Hywp
transaction
c590db29bda6d968705af67c84b4aeed338ed7870b42f1feee2556dbbac4bfd7
confirmations
286773
spent
true